| Hello, I'm getting a new computer at Xmas, looking to build one myself however, as much as i know about operating a computer, fixing computers etc I don't actually know much about hardware so i was hoping i could get some advice please. I'm from the UK so any suggested buys if they were UK ones then it would be appreciated please. What i want it for... Just want the computer to run fast, act as a media server to an extent for my PS3 but it will have its own HD monitor separately but any well priced 24" or over HD monitors then free feel to suggest. I've got a large music collection and have ripped all of my movies onto my previous hard drives so I will put them all onto the computer and just want it for general stuff. I would want it to play at HD quality e.g. I had a blue ray quality movie I would want that to be displayed at the full potential and i may use it to run some music software e.g. cubase. How much? About £400ish I can extend the budget a bit more if need be. After receiving some advice I've been suggested something along the lines of... CPU - Athlon IIx4 620 http://www.ebuyer.com/product/173368 - £77.12 or PhenomII x2 550 http://www.ebuyer.com/product/166518 - £73.81 Mobo - MSI 770-C45 http://www.ebuyer.com/product/165438 - £47.81 RAM - DDR3 RAM http://www.ebuyer.com/product/178943 - £80 http://www.cclonline.com/product-inf...115&tid=frooct - £67.50 Video card: I recommend 4670 instead. Cheaper and faster than GT220 http://www.ebuyer.com/product/173208 - £51.79 Case - I recommend Casecom 6788 as budget case http://www.ebuyer.com/product/172779 - £24 PSU - http://www.ebuyer.com/product/135159 - £50 DVD +/- - http://www.ebuyer.com/product/169683 - £16.99 HD - http://www.ebuyer.com/product/173804 - Hard drive - £57.99 Your thoughts would be appreciated please. Thanks, Also to have bluetooth/wireless would i just need to install a PCI? thanks |
